Overview

Magnetic resonance imaging is used in developing images of human body. It uses magnetic field and pulses of radio wave energy to generate pictures of organs of the body. MRIs are performed to detect tumors, injuries, or infections. It can be performed on the head, chest, abdomen, bones and joints. This book presents the complex subject of magnetic resonance imaging in the most comprehensible and easy to understand language. It will prove to be immensely beneficial to students and researchers in this field.
